SSC CGL DEST — what the Data Entry Speed Test checks

The Data Entry Speed Test (DEST) in SSC CGL is required mainly for the post of Tax Assistant in the CBDT and CBIC. Unlike a simple typing test, DEST measures your data entry speed — how quickly and accurately you can key in a printed English passage on a computer. The standard benchmark is 8,000 key depressions per hour, evaluated on a passage of about 2,000 key depressions in 15 minutes.

Because DEST counts key depressions rather than words, every keystroke matters — letters, spaces, punctuation and capitalisation all count. This makes consistency more important than bursts of speed.
